We’re hiring: Technical Account Manager
Want to be a trusted security adviser to enterprise customers? As a Technical Account Manager, you’ll own technical relationships with our Managed Security Service customers, helping them get maximum value from their Microsoft security investments.
What you’ll do:
- Own and grow trusted technical relationships
- Advise on Microsoft 365 & Azure security
- Lead service reviews and showcase value through KPIs
- Identify cross-service opportunities across security & consultancy
- Champion service quality and customer success
What you bring:
- Strong Microsoft security expertise
- Excellent communication & stakeholder skills
- A customer-first, consultative mindset
Why join us:
- Be a trusted adviser, not just an account contact
- Flexible working – remote + time in our offices
- Work with brilliant people on meaningful security outcomes

How to prepare for a job interview at Sapphire
✨Know Your Microsoft Security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Microsoft 365 and Azure security. Be ready to discuss specific features, benefits, and how they can help enterprise customers. This will show that you're not just familiar with the products but can also advise clients effectively.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
As a Technical Account Manager, you'll need to communicate complex technical information clearly. Practice explaining technical concepts in simple terms. You might even want to prepare a few examples of how you've successfully communicated with stakeholders in the past.
✨Demonstrate a Customer-First Mindset
Prepare to share examples of how you've put customers first in previous roles. Think about times when you've gone above and beyond to ensure customer satisfaction or how you've identified opportunities for them to get more value from their investments.
✨Be Ready for Scenario Questions
Expect scenario-based questions where you'll need to demonstrate your problem-solving skills. Think about potential challenges a customer might face with their security setup and how you would address those issues. This will highlight your consultative approach and ability to champion service quality.
